Location: Stockport, London, or home-based within the UKAs a Water Engineer (Consutlant, Senior or Principal level) within our growing consultancy, you will lead and grow the Water Environment team to address our clients’ flood risk and drainage challenges, delivering practical and environmentally positive engineering solutions.You will design, assess, and manage water and drainage systems across a variety of projects, including flood risk assessments, surface water management, and sustainable drainage design. You will collaborate with engineers, planners, and environmental specialists to deliver sustainable, evidence-based outcomes for clients in both the public and private sectors.Who are we?We are Envance, an environmental and sustainability management consultancy driven by our values and core beliefs. We believe that a better future for people and the planet can go hand in hand with success in the present.Our purpose is to help clients become more sustainable and to realise the opportunities and benefits that responsible practices bring to their business.Achieving positive outcomes and adding value is central to our approach. We provide pragmatic and innovative advice, embracing new and emerging methods wherever possible.We believe collaboration is key. By working with our clients and supply chain partners to deliver projects and improve performance, we can create a better world now and for the future.Key ResponsibilitiesLead or contribute to the design and assessment of flood risk and drainage infrastructure projects.Develop and review Sustainable Urban Drainage Systems (SuDS) and surface water management strategies.Undertake hydrological, hydraulic, and water resource modelling using tools such as HEC-RAS, TUFLOW, MIKE SHE, or InfoWorks ICM.Analyse data from fieldwork, GIS, and remote sensing to inform engineering design and project delivery.Prepare high-quality technical reports, designs, and client presentations.Provide expert advice on water resource management, flood resilience, and drainage design.Liaise with clients, regulators, and local authorities to ensure compliance with technical and environmental standards.RequirementsDegree (or higher) in Civil Engineering, Water Engineering, or a related discipline.Experience in flood risk management, drainage design, and SuDS delivery.Proficiency in relevant design and modelling software (e.g. Civil 3D, MicroDrainage, InfoWorks ICM).Strong analytical, written, and communication skills.A collaborative, proactive approach and a genuine interest in sustainable water management.Working towards or holding Chartership or Incorporated Engineer (IEng) status through ICE, CIWEM, or a similar professional body is desirable.BenefitsDiscretionary profit share scheme33 days annual leave including bank holidays3 paid volunteer days each yearOption purchase additional leaveAdditional leave after 2 years of serviceAn additional day’s leave for your birthdayMonthly wellbeing allowance to spend on a sport or activity of your choiceHealthcare schemeUnlimited training budget with a tailored training plan Enhanced contributory pension schemeCycle to work schemeFree parking
